SUMMARY: St Newlyn East (Cornish: Eglosniwlin) is an idyllic country Cornish village approximately 3 miles South of the bustling coastal town of Newquay. The most recent census listed the population at 1940, meaning it enjoys a quieter pace of life to that of its large neighbour Newquay. Named after the patron saint of the church, St Newlina, The beautiful Church sits proudly in the heart of the village and dates back to Norman times.

There's a brilliant range of daily amenities including highly regarded independent butchers, traditional village pub, local convenience store as well as an Ofsted "good" rated primary school and a well-equipped local park that is directly opposite from this property.
